How to Set Up Custom Lists

Custom Lists give you complete control over your content organization, allowing you to hand-pick specific games and arrange them in any order you prefer.


Understanding Custom Lists

Custom Lists are perfect for organizing your content into themed collections that align with your content strategy. For example:

Imagine you're creating content around major sporting events throughout the year. You might want to:

  • Create a "Tennis Highlights" list featuring quizzes about Grand Slams
  • Set up a "Football Specials" list with content about major championships
  • Organize seasonal content into separate lists for better management

This way, you can easily access and manage themed content collections without mixing different sports or events and display them in your site.

Creating a Custom List

  1. Click the "Create" button in the Lists dashboard
  2. Enter a name for your list
  3. Select "Custom" as the list type
  4. Use the filters to find specific content:
    • Select content type (e.g., Classic Quiz, Either/Or, Poll)
    • Filter by status (Active, Inactive, Expired)
    • Choose sort order (Ascending/Descending)
  5. Click the "+" button next to items to add them to your list
  6. Use drag-and-drop to arrange items in your preferred order
  7. Click "Save" to create your list

Visual Guide 


Step 1: Click the 'Create' button to start creating your list

Step 2.  Enter a name for your list and select 'Custom' as the list type

Step 3: Use filters to find specific content - select content type, status, and sort order. Add content to your list using the '+' button next to each item. You can also use 'Add all' to add multiple items at once

Step 4: Arrange your content using drag-and-drop functionality. Use the '-' button to remove items if needed

Step 5: Click 'Save' to finalize your Custom List
